GENOISE WITH PASSION FRUIT SWISS MERINGUE BUTTERCREAM



Genoise with Passion Fruit Swiss Meringue Buttercream image

Provided by Martha Stewart

Number Of Ingredients 8

Nonstick cooking spray with flour
6 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
5 large eggs
1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ons superfine sugar
2/3 cup cake flour, sifted
1/2 cup cornstarch
Passion-Fruit Swiss Meringue Buttercream

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ees with rack set in the lower third. Spray a 9-by-3-inch round baking pan with nonstick cooking spray; line pan with a parchment paper round and spray again. Set aside.
  • In a small saucepan, melt butter over medium-high heat until nut-brown in color, about 8 minutes. Remove pan from heat and pour butter into a large bowl, leaving any burned sediment behind; stir in vanilla and keep warm (110 to 120 degrees).
  • Lightly whisk together eggs and sugar in the bowl of an electric mixer; set mixer over (but not touching) simmering water and heat, whisking constantly, until lukewarm to the touch. Transfer bowl to electric mixer fitted with the whisk attachment and beat on high speed until light, airy, and quadruple in volume, at least 5 minutes. Whisk 1 cup egg mixture into warm melted butter mixture; set aside.
  • Sift together flour and cornstarch. Gently and quickly fold half the flour mixture into remaining egg mixture until all the flour is absorbed. Repeat process with remaining flour mixture. Fold in butter mixture to combine and transfer to prepared baking pan.
  • Transfer pan to oven and bake until golden brown and starts to shrink slightly from the sides of the pan, 20 to 30 minutes. If possible, avoid opening the oven door until cake has baked at least 30 minutes, as cake is fragile and may fall. Remove cake from oven and unmold immediately onto a wire rack to cool. Let cool completely before cutting into layers and frosting with buttercream.

10 BEST PASSION FRUIT RECIPES - THE SPRUCE EATS

From thespruceeats.com
  • Passion Fruit Butter. Passionfruit butter is also known as passion fruit curd and it's a favorite in Australian and South American cuisines. It's a deliciously sweet, creamy condiment that can be used in a variety of recipes or simply enjoyed as a spread.
  • Salsa de Maracuyá. Salsa de maracuyá (Spanish for passion fruit) is a basic passion fruit sauce that's a South American favorite. This recipe pairs the fruit with garlic and vinegar to give it a savory touch that is fabulous with chicken.
  • Passion Fruit Salad Dressing. While fresh passion fruit is at its best, you'll definitely want to try this tropical salad dressing. This recipe is also from South America and it's incredibly simple.
  • Chicken Breasts With Ginger Passion Fruit Sauce. Chicken and passion fruit are a perfect pairing. This recipe goes even further, bringing fresh ginger into the mix.
  • Passion Fruit Mousse. While entrees are great, the passion fruit really shines in dessert recipes. It makes a fabulous mousse, especially when topped with a crust of macadamia nuts and coconut.
  • Passion Fruit Tart. Tarts are another fun way to get the sweet taste of passion fruit onto the dessert table. They're surprisingly easy to make, so if you haven't tried one yet, here's your chance.
  • Passion Fruit Caramels. If you want to dabble in candy making, pick up some passion fruit puree and whip up these caramels. The fruit gives the sweet candy a tart flavor that's a lot of fun and rather addicting.
  • Passion Fruit Sangria. Passion fruit is also a perfect flavor to bring into your drinks. A recipe like this white wine sangria makes it easy to share the fruit's tropical taste at your summer parties.
  • Spiked Passion Fruit Horchata. The spiked passion fruit horchata puts a passion fruit twist on a traditional Mexican drink. Horchata is a creamy rice drink that looks like milk.
  • Bem Casados With Passion Fruit Curd. Remember that passion fruit butter? It is the ideal filling for these delicious little cookies. Bem casados are often called "happily married cookies" because they're served to wedding guests in Brazil.
